Check petrol, diesel rates for Delhi, Mumbai, Kolkata after fresh price hike
State-run oil marketing companies on Tuesday increased petrol and diesel prices across major metro cities for the second time in less than a week. The latest revision comes after fuel prices were raised by ₹3 per litre last week.
According to an official from the oil ministry, oil companies were still incurring losses of nearly ₹750 crore per day on the sale of petrol, diesel and liquified petroleum gas (LPG) despite the earlier hike.
